Intelligence follows the same split. Resource-control owns portfolio
identity and provision-level class `I` metering when Railiance procures a
model API, reserved weights, or inference host. State Hub owns agent-session
token evidence. Fin-hub books the plan invoice, records entitlement, joins
those inputs, and reports effectiveness. It does not invent a `resource_id`,
parse sessions, or emit technical usage or allocation as if it were
resource-control.
